The Road Ahead – Guidance to court procedures from the Family Division
As the Family Court slowly eases out of lockdown along with the rest of the country, we are now facing a new look to court procedures. The Family Court is entering a hybrid world where some hearings will continue to be heard, remotely, others will be physical and some may be a mixture. The President of the Family Division Sir Andrew McFarlane has today provided what he calls The Road Ahead. This is a comprehensive document explaining how the Family Court is going to look and operate for what is likely to be the remainder of 2020 if not continuing into the Spring of 2021.
The Road Ahead statement can be accessed here and is essential reading for anyone who is currently involved in family court proceedings or is considering making an application in the near future.
